So if you wanted to go Hive Mind and Devouring Swarm what would be the best traits and civics to pick considering that most likely this is an attack and keep attacking type of game where you conquer all other AI's.

In addition to Devouring Swarm would you go for:
One Mind +15% Unity
Divided Attention +2 Core worlds
Subspace Ephapse +15% Naval Capacity
Subsumed Will -20% Ethics cost

And what would be the other civic once you research the tech to allow it?

For traits I think two negative traits are no-brainers:
Repugnant -25 opinion (-1) You already have -1000
Decadent - 10% Happiness with no slaves (-1) Happiness doesn't effect you anyway. But not sure if this one will.

So with 3 or 4 positive points which ones would you pick:
Industrious +15 Minerals (2)
Thrifty +15 Energy (2)
Very Strong +40% Army Damage and +10% Minerals (3)
Extremely Adaptive +20% Habitability (4)
Traditional +10% Unity (1)
Rapid Breeders +20% Growth (1)

Or some other traits.

Considering this is a game where you take over lot's of planets You won't end up with high technology, high unity etc. because of the expansion. And minerals are probably a necessity to build those fleets and armies.

For those that have played this type what did you pick?

Last time, I went with:

Civics: Devouring Swarm, One Mind
Traits: Sedentary, Repugnant, Industrious, Enduring, Traditional
(Decadent is incompatible with Hive-Minded)

I went with "Subsumed Will" as the third civic after unlocking it, to help counteract the non-amazing unity income when activating the Unity Ambitions, but Subspace Ephapse is tempting; naval capacity is inherently useful.
After bio-ascension, traits were: Robust, Erudite, Very Strong, Traditional, Repugnant
 
The final adaptability bonus is insanely good for the devouring swarm. You may be thinking "+1 mineral is garbage" but that's completely wrong. Double resource buildings get DOUBLE benefits from the capital! They also reap both benefits from the +mineral+food tiles, netting you far more resources. Surround your capital with farms and you are getting +4 minerals from the tradition in addition to +8 minerals and +8 food from adjacency. Every world is getting +12 more resource output! You can stack up that population growth bonus without sacrificing mineral income and that's HUGE.

Unfortunately that will probably go away with the new planet revamp. Enjoy it while you can.
